Description

Compiled by a famous teacher, this splendid gallery is geared toward intermediate-level students. Its complete and detailed drawings feature a tremendous variety of styles, poses, and techniques. Created by top students at prestigious art schools of the 1930s, this handbook also offers an authentic reflection of the era's excellent draftsmanship.

Author Biography:

Canadian artist George Brandt Bridgman (1865-1943) studied at the École des Beaux Arts in Paris and taught at New York City's Art Students League. Generations of students have learned the principles of anatomy and figure drawing from his books, which rank among Dover's most popular art instruction texts.
